Leeds United’s Last-Minute Transfer Push: A Second Chance at Signing Manchester City’s James McAtee?

As the clock ticks down to the 11pm transfer deadline, Leeds United is working tirelessly to secure their first signing of the window. With the Whites’ promotion bid hanging in the balance, manager Daniel Farke is desperate to bolster his squad with some much-needed reinforcements.

One player who has been on Farke’s radar for some time is Southampton attacker Cameron Archer. The 23-year-old has been linked with a deadline-day move to Leeds United, and with the Saints signing Victor Udoh from Royal Antwerp, the door may be open for Archer to leave. However, with several other clubs also interested in the young attacker, Leeds will need to act quickly to secure his signature.

While Archer remains the Whites’ top target, another player who could become available in the dying hours of the window is Manchester City’s James McAtee. The 22-year-old attacking midfielder has been linked with a move to Leeds United for some time, and with his gametime limited at City, a transfer could be on the cards.

According to a report by The Telegraph, McAtee remains unlikely to leave City, but it’s “not beyond the realms of possibility that something develops late.” With just hours left in the window, Leeds will need to move quickly to secure McAtee’s signature.

The young midfielder has started just one game in 2025 for City, featuring once off the bench in his side’s last three matches. His lack of playing time has undoubtedly affected his development, and a move to Leeds could be just what he needs to kickstart his career.

While McAtee could be a good backup option for Leeds, the club’s primary focus remains on securing Archer’s signature. The Southampton attacker is seen as a key player in Farke’s promotion bid, and his arrival could be the catalyst for a successful second half of the season.
